Output b3b6db63dfa3813916faebcdc01ed8dadd8ec478e9944ba1b1eb87f1582683cd:84

value
104056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a04eeb2cc999a20f6a827fcc53dcf880604d296d OP_EQUAL
address
3GJeabo1u6Q4CigjY4S8JMzGuLHBLnN1dt
transaction
b3b6db63dfa3813916faebcdc01ed8dadd8ec478e9944ba1b1eb87f1582683cd
confirmations
170201
spent
true